How to Wash Thinline Saddle Pads for Better Horse Comfort

If you’re a horse enthusiast, you know how important it is to keep your equipment clean and well-maintained. One essential piece of equipment is the Thinline saddle pad, known for its exceptional comfort and protection. However, regular cleaning is vital to keep it in good condition. In this guide, we’ll explore how to wash Thinline saddle pads effectively.

Why Clean Thinline Saddle Pads?

Cleaning your Thinline saddle pads is crucial not only for maintaining their appearance but also for ensuring your horse’s health and comfort. Dirty pads can harbor bacteria, leading to skin irritations for your horse. Thus, regular cleaning is a must.

Materials Needed

  • Soft brush
  • Mild detergent
  • Warm water
  • Bucket or tub
  • Clean, dry towels

Step-by-Step Cleaning Process

Step 1: Shake Off Dirt and Hair

Begin by gently shaking your Thinline saddle pad to remove loose dirt and horse hair. Using a soft brush, brush off any remaining dust.

Step 2: Prepare a Cleaning Solution

Fill a bucket or tub with warm water and add a small amount of mild detergent. The detergent should be gentle enough to preserve the pad’s material.

Step 3: Soak the Pad

Immerse the saddle pad in the soapy water and allow it to soak for 15-20 minutes. This helps loosen any embedded dirt or stains.

Step 4: Scrub Gently

Using your soft brush, gently scrub the pad to remove any stubborn stains. Focus on areas with visible dirt or discoloration.

Step 5: Rinse Thoroughly

Rinse the saddle pad thoroughly with clean water to ensure all soap is removed. Repeat rinsing until the water runs clear.

Step 6: Dry Properly

Place the pad on a towel and roll it up to squeeze out excess water. Hang or lay flat to dry, ensuring it’s completely dry before using it again.

Additional Tips for Maintenance

To extend the life of your Thinline saddle pads, store them in a dry, cool place and avoid prolonged exposure to direct sunlight. Regular maintenance is key to their longevity.

Conclusion

By following these steps, you can ensure that your Thinline saddle pads remain clean, hygienic, and comfortable for your horse. Remember, a well-maintained pad contributes to a happier, healthier horse.

FAQs

How often should I wash my Thinline saddle pads?

It’s recommended to wash your saddle pads every few weeks, depending on frequency of use and conditions.

Can I machine wash Thinline saddle pads?

While some saddle pads can be machine washed, it’s best to refer to the manufacturer’s instructions to avoid damage.

What type of detergent should I use?

Use a mild detergent without harsh chemicals to preserve the material’s integrity.
